The Department of Agriculture is spearheading a comprehensive transformation of the country’s agri-food system. Guided by the Masaganang Bagong Pilipinas agenda, this transformation seeks to secure the nation’s food supply, uplift farmer and fisherfolk livelihoods, and modernize production through expanded agri-fishery zones, mechanization, post-harvest and logistics upgrades, digitalization, and strengthened partnerships with local governments and the private sector.
The 2025 National Agri-fishery Investment Forum provides a platform to align these efforts into a unified process. It will:
Present the current agri-food system status and investment outlook;
Share the Department’s four-year investment plan and financing mechanisms;
Facilitate discussions on provincial commodity investment priorities; and
Generate support and complementation from government units, agencies, and partners.
The Forum aims to:
Identify key commodities prioritized by Provincial Governors and local legislative agriculture committees.
Determine priority value chain segments within these commodities that require targeted funding or interventions.
Generate an indicative list of investment-ready interventions supported by local leaders and the Department.
Formalize expressions of support through signed commitment documents or declarations.
This Forum affirms the Department’s commitment to transform strategic planning into concrete, coordinated investments to pave the way for a modern, resilient, and inclusive agri-fisheries sector..
